This article presents a comprehensive scientific analysis of the fundamental relationship between mathematics and artificial intelligence (AI). Artificial intelligence systems are deeply rooted in mathematical theory, relying on linear algebra, calculus, probability theory, statistics, optimization, and discrete mathematics. The effectiveness, scalability, and reliability of AI algorithms are determined by the robustness of their mathematical foundations. Particular attention is given to machine learning and deep learning, where mathematical modeling and numerical optimization techniques play a central role. The paper demonstrates that mathematics is not merely a supporting tool for AI, but its essential structural backbone, enabling intelligent systems to learn, generalize, and make decisions under uncertainty.
